I am and always will be a die-hard fbody fan, but i completely disagree about the 4th gen V6 potential and heres why.
To get the car into any decent performance numbers, it takes SIGNIFICANT modding and some form of tune. On top of this, the trannys had a notorious reputation that i can personally confirm because mine when out at 50K with nothing but an intake and a muffler.
The amount of money it would take to whip this vehicle into shape would be better spent on just getting one with an LS1 in it.
Its a little more complicated than just slapping on forced induction, you have to add supporting mods such as new tranny, half decent tires, tune, exhaust, and probably some form of rear end. Because even the LS1 rearends were shattering with hard launches.
All of this just to make it ALMOST as fast as a Z28.
